Researchers have developed GSA-YOLO, a new lightweight framework designed for real-time X-ray security inspection. This model, based on YOLOv8n, incorporates structured sparsity and adaptive knowledge distillation to improve detection accuracy and inference speed. GSA-YOLO integrates Group Lasso, Sparse Structure Selection, and an Adaptive Knowledge Distillation mechanism to enhance feature representation and reduce model size. Evaluations on the HiXray and PIDray datasets show GSA-YOLO achieves a leading inference speed of 189.62 FPS with reduced computational cost, alongside improved mAP50:95 scores compared to the baseline.
